Program Evaluation Services Youth Leadership Program Evaluation Period: 2026–2027
Organizational Background
Council for the Advancement of African Canadians in Alberta operating as Africa Centre invites qualified consultants or evaluation firms to submit proposals to conduct an independent evaluation of our Ujima Youth Leadership and Mentorship
Program.
Africa Centre's Youth Leadership and Mentorship Programs are designed to empower youth through leadership development, community engagement, mentorship, and skills-building opportunities. The program seeks to strengthen youth confidence, leadership capacity, and civic participation while fostering positive outcomes for young people and their communities.
As part of our commitment to continuous improvement, accountability, and community impact, we are seeking an external evaluator to conduct a comprehensive assessment of our program’s implementation, outcomes, and overall effectiveness.
Purpose of the Evaluation
The purpose of this evaluation is to:
-
Assess the overall effectiveness and impact of the programs.
-
Evaluate outcomes for participating youth, including leadership development, skills acquisition, confidence, and community engagement.
-
Review program design, delivery methods, and implementation practices.
-
Gather feedback from program participants, staff, partners, and stakeholders.
-
Identify strengths, challenges, and opportunities for program improvement.
-
Provide recommendations for strengthening program outcomes and sustainability.
-
Support evidence-based decision-making for future program planning and funding.
Scope of Work
The selected evaluator will conduct a comprehensive evaluation that includes, but is not limited to, the following activities:
a) Program Review
- Review all program materials, including curriculum, program models, reports, and existing data.
- Assess alignment between program objectives, activities, and intended outcomes.
- Examine program implementation and delivery across program cycles.
b) Impact Evaluation
- Assess the impact of the program on youth participants, including:
- Leadership skills development
- Personal growth and confidence
- Civic and community engagement
- Educational or career readiness outcomes
- Identify measurable changes in participants over the course of their involvement.
c) Data Collection and Analysis
- Develop or refine evaluation frameworks and indicators where necessary.
- Collect quantitative and qualitative data through:
- Surveys
- Interviews
- Focus groups
- Case studies
- Program data review
- Analyze program participation data and outcomes.
d) Stakeholder Engagement
- Gather feedback from key stakeholders, including:
- Youth participants and alumni
- Program facilitators and staff
- Community partners
- Mentors and volunteers
- Assess stakeholder perceptions of program value and effectiveness.
e) Equity and Community Lens
- Assess how the program supports equitable participation and outcomes.
- Evaluate how the program responds to the needs and lived realities of the communities served.
f) Reporting and Recommendations
-
Produce evaluation reports with findings and actionable recommendations.
-
Provide guidance on:
- Program improvement and refinement
- Measurement frameworks
- Sustainability and scaling opportunities
-
Present findings to program leadership and stakeholders.
Expected Deliverables
The evaluator will be expected to provide:
- Evaluation Work Plan and Methodology
- Evaluation Framework and Indicators
- Interim Progress Brief(s)
- Stakeholder Engagement Summary
- Midpoint Evaluation Report
- Final Comprehensive Evaluation Report
- Presentation of Findings and Recommendations
In addition, evaluators are also expected to:
- Develop a long-term impact measurement framework
- Create participant outcome indicators and tracking tools
- Support data collection systems or dashboards
- Produce participant success stories or case studies
- Conduct a cost-benefit or return-on-investment analysis
- Provide capacity-building for staff on evaluation and data collection
- Help design future program monitoring tools
Reports should include clear data analysis, key insights, and practical recommendations for program improvement.
Qualifications
Qualified evaluators should demonstrate:
- Experience conducting program evaluations for nonprofit or youth development programs
- Strong expertise in mixed-methods evaluation (qualitative and quantitative)
- Experience working with community-based organizations
- Understanding of youth leadership, community engagement, and empowerment programming
- Ability to apply equity-informed or culturally responsive evaluation approaches
- Strong data analysis, facilitation, and reporting skills
- Strong digital skills
Preference will be given to evaluators with experience working with racialized communities and youth-centered programs.
